Pinewood Technologies, a leading provider of innovative software solutions, is headquartered in Great Britain and operates extensively across Europe and beyond. Founded in 2010, the company has established itself within the automotive and retail industries, focusing on delivering cutting-edge dealership management systems and cloud-based applications. Pinewood's flagship products, including Pinewood DMS, are designed to enhance operational efficiency and customer engagement, setting them apart with their user-friendly interfaces and robust functionality. In 2024, Pinewood Technologies reported total carbon emissions of approximately 8,803,000 kg CO2e. This figure includes 3,634,000 kg CO2e from Scope 1 emissions, primarily from stationary combustion, and 13,373,000 kg CO2e from Scope 2 emissions. Additionally, Scope 3 emissions accounted for 6,793,000 kg CO2e, primarily from employee commuting. In 2023, the company recorded total emissions of about 9,372,000 kg CO2e, with Scope 1 emissions at 3,337,000 kg CO2e and Scope 2 emissions at 4,026,000 kg CO2e. Scope 3 emissions were minimal, at just 1,000 kg CO2e from business travel. Pinewood Technologies has shown a significant reduction in emissions over the years. From 2022 to 2024, total emissions decreased from approximately 21,347,000 kg CO2e to 8,803,000 kg CO2e, indicating a strong commitment to reducing their carbon footprint. However, there are currently no specific reduction targets or climate pledges documented.
